Brussels Private Walking Tour

Brussels is not only about the beer, waffles and chocolate! This amazing city is more than a 1000 years old. Today the name Brussels stands for the meeting point for all the diverse cultures in Europe. It is a cosmopolitan city where many different cultures live together and where different languages can be heard on each street. Brussels also has an important international vocation: as the european capital, the city is home to the European Commission and to the Council of ministers of the European Union (EU).

Variety and contrast can be found in the different architectural styles of Brussels, the former capital of the medieval Duchy of Brabant. Gothic cathedrals and churches are next to – and sometimes in stark contrast with – gracious classical facades like the buildings around the Royal Square. Discover this and much more in a 2 hours walking tour that includes some of the best sightseeings of the city.

You will see:
* The Grand-Place * The famous Manneken-pis * The royal galleries and Galleries * The rue des Bouchers (street of butchers) * The Cathedral of Saint Michel-and- Gudule * The place Saint Cathrine * The historical centre with the Royal place * The church Our-Lady of Sablon * The Justice Palace * European headquarters You will learn about * History of the city * Its importance as the capital and home of the European Union * Language boundary and Brussels dialect * Global significance of the European Quarter complex * Treaty of Brussels * Architectural treasures * Cultural scene and important artists * Legends and myths * Museums and art galleries.
